Outsourcing Game Development: Unlocking Potential for Businesses
In today's fast-paced digital world, businesses are constantly seeking innovative ways to stand out in a competitive market. One of the most effective strategies gaining momentum is the outsourcing of game development. This strategic move is not just about cost-cutting; it encompasses a wide array of benefits that can significantly enhance the quality and reach of your product. Let’s delve into how outsourcing game development can transform your business and why it is a crucial consideration for any serious developer.
Understanding Outsourcing in Game Development
Outsourcing game development refers to the practice of hiring external teams or professionals to undertake various aspects of game design and development. This can include everything from concept art and game design to complete production and post-launch support. Here’s why this approach is increasingly becoming a norm:
- Access to Global Talent: By outsourcing, companies can tap into a global pool of talent that may not be available locally.
- Cost Efficiency: Outsourcing can often be more cost-effective than hiring full-time employees, especially for specialized roles.
- Focus on Core Business: It allows businesses to concentrate on their main objectives while experts handle game development.
- Scalability: You can easily scale your development team up or down, depending on project needs.
- Speed: Access to experienced teams can significantly cut down development time, helping you to get to market faster.
Benefits of Outsourcing Game Development
1. Cost Savings
One of the most compelling reasons to consider outsourcing game development is the potential for substantial cost savings. By leveraging teams in regions with lower labor costs, businesses can maintain high-quality outputs without breaking the bank. Moreover, outsourcing eliminates costs associated with recruitment, training, and employee benefits.
2. Access to Expertise
Outsourcing provides access to specialized skills and experience that may not be present in-house. Whether you need advanced programming capabilities, unique art styles, or innovative gameplay mechanics, expert outsourced teams can deliver high-quality work that stands out. This is particularly beneficial for niche projects requiring specific expertise.
3. Faster Time to Market
In the competitive gaming industry, speeding up the development timeline can be a decisive factor for success. Outsourced teams can often start immediately and contribute more resources to a project, which can lead to a faster time to market. This means less waiting and more opportunity to capture player interest quickly.
4. Focus on Core Activities
By outsourcing game development, businesses can redirect their attention and resources to core activities such as marketing, business growth strategies, and player engagement efforts. This division of labor allows for improved efficiency and potential revenue growth.
5. Enhanced Innovation
When you work with a diverse group of developers from various cultural and geographical backgrounds, you obtain a variety of perspectives that can enhance creativity and innovation. This diversity can lead to fresher ideas and inventive solutions that may not have emerged in a more homogenous environment.
Choosing the Right Partner for Outsourcing Game Development
While the advantages of outsourcing are significant, the success of your endeavor greatly depends on your choice of partner. Here are key considerations when selecting an outsourcing company:
1. Portfolio and Experience
When assessing potential partners, examine their portfolio carefully. Look for companies that have experience in developing games that align with your vision and objectives. A proven track record of success is often indicative of the quality you can expect.
2. Communication Skills
Effective communication is crucial in any partnership, especially when dealing with complex projects like game development. Ensure that your chosen team has strong communication practices and is proficient in your language, which will facilitate smooth collaboration.
3. Cultural Fit
Cultural alignment is essential. Your outsourcing team should share similar values and attitudes to ensure a harmonious working relationship. This can tremendously impact the project's progress and the overall synergy between teams.
4. Technological Proficiency
Different teams specialize in different technologies and platforms. Ensure that the partner you choose is well-versed in the technologies required to bring your game concept to fruition.
5. Client Testimonials and Reviews
Before finalizing a partnership, seek out client reviews and testimonials. Feedback from previous clients can provide insight into the reliability, work ethic, and quality of output from the outsourcing provider.
The Process of Outsourcing Game Development
Outsourcing game development involves a strategic process that ensures collaboration and success. Below are the essential steps to guide you through this journey:
1. Define Your Requirements
Begin by outlining the project scope, including the type of game, target audience, specific features, and budget constraints. Clear requirements are crucial for the outsourcing team to understand your vision.
2. Research and Select an Outsourcing Partner
Use the previously mentioned criteria to research and shortlist potential partners. Reach out to them, discuss your project requirements, and assess their enthusiasm for the project.
3. Establish Clear Communication Channels
Set up robust communication channels to facilitate ongoing dialogue. Scheduled updates, regular check-ins, and dedicated project management tools can help keep everyone aligned.
4. Set Milestones and Objectives
Define specific milestones and objectives that the team must meet throughout the development process. This can help in tracking progress and maintaining accountability.
5. Monitor Development and Provide Feedback
Regularly assess the development process and provide constructive feedback. Open channels of communication will ensure that any issues are promptly addressed and resolved.
Challenges of Outsourcing Game Development
While outsourcing can be highly beneficial, it is not without its challenges. Here are some common obstacles that businesses may face:
1. Coordination Across Time Zones
Working with teams in different time zones can lead to delays in communication and project timelines if not managed properly. Careful planning and scheduling can mitigate this issue.
2. Quality Control
Ensuring the quality of work from an outsourced team can be challenging. Establish clear standards and methodologies for quality assurance early in the project.
3. Intellectual Property Concerns
Outsourcing often raises concerns about intellectual property rights. It is crucial to have solid contracts in place protecting your assets and ideas throughout the development process.
4. Cultural Differences
Cultural misunderstandings may arise, potentially affecting the workflow. Promoting cultural awareness and understanding within your team can help in overcoming these barriers.
Conclusion: Embracing the Future of Game Development
As the gaming industry continues to evolve, outsourcing game development stands out as a key strategy for businesses seeking to enhance creativity, efficiency, and output quality. By embracing this approach, companies can leverage global talent, reduce costs, and focus on their core business objectives. The journey of outsourcing may pose its challenges, but with careful planning, open communication, and the right partnerships, the potential rewards significantly outweigh the risks.
Ultimately, the future of game development is bright for those willing to adapt and innovate. As you consider embarking on your outsourcing journey, remember that the right strategy can unlock unmatched potential for your business, paving the way for success in the dynamic world of gaming.
For more information on how outsourcing can benefit your game development needs, visit Pingle Studio.